JP Morgan Chase's FYC Position: Q2 2026 in Review
JP Morgan Chase reduced its First Trust Small Cap Growth AlphaDEX Fund (FYC) stake by 28% in Q2 2026, selling an estimated $26K and leaving 595 shares worth $74.8K. The position accounts for ﹤0.01% of the portfolio, ranked #6245.
JP Morgan Chase first reported a position in FYC in Q4 2021 and has held it in 8 quarters since. The position peaked at $79.2K in Q3 2025. 177 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old FYC as of Q2 2026.
